Abstract
The oxides of nitrogen contribute a significant amount of the total loading of air pollution and of acid rain. However, they do not seem to be present on carbonate stone to the same degree as sulfur dioxide. Thermochemical theory suggests that the nitrate reaction would not be favored. Moreover the situation is complicated by the possibility of nitrate fixation from the atmosphere through biological processes.
